Group 1 - Central Huijin Investment Co., Ltd. and its subsidiary, Central Huijin Asset Management, held a total market value of 1.28 trillion yuan in stock ETFs by the end of June, representing a nearly 23% increase from the end of last year, marking a historical high [1] - The number of stock ETFs held by Central Huijin Asset Management at the end of June was 1.58 times that of the end of last year, with multiple broad-based ETFs receiving over 1 billion shares in increases [1] - Central Huijin's significant increase in ETF holdings signals a strong commitment to maintaining market stability and reflects confidence in the future development of China's capital market [1][2] Group 2 - Central Huijin recognizes the current valuation levels in the market and aims to play the role of patient and long-term capital, indicating that the overall valuation of the A-share market is at a relatively low historical level [3] - The investment behavior of Central Huijin serves as a demonstration effect, promoting long-term and value investing principles, which can encourage both retail and institutional investors to focus on overall market trends rather than individual stock fluctuations [4] - The substantial increase in ETF holdings by Central Huijin reflects a recognition of the current market value and a determination to maintain market stability, which is crucial for the healthy and stable development of the capital market [4]
